IFF Hedge Fund Activity: Q1 2025 in Review

718 of the 7,458 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in International Flavors & Fragrances (IFF) for Q1 2025, worth a combined $18.5B — down 7.8% from $20.1B a quarter earlier.

Sellers outnumbered buyers: 103 funds closed out of IFF and 74 opened new positions — a net loss of 29 holders — while 265 trimmed existing stakes and 256 added.

The largest buyer was First Eagle Investment Management, adding an estimated $202M. The largest seller was Norges Bank, cutting an estimated $145M.
